What is Drift Beach Dubai?
Drift Beach Dubai is a private, adults-only beach club nestled within the One&Only Royal Mirage. Known for its award-winning architecture, minimalist Mediterranean décor, and 5-star service, it offers:
- An infinity pool overlooking the Arabian Gulf
- Private beachfront access with cabanas and daybeds
- A chic Provence-inspired restaurant and bar
- DJ-curated music and a fashionable crowd
Since opening in 2017, it has become a go-to destination for Dubai’s elite, celebrities, and discerning tourists.

Pricing: Is Drift Worth the Money?
Yes — if you’re looking for luxury and exclusivity.
Entry Fees (as of 2025):
Day | Single Sunbed | Poolside Cabana | Private Beach Cabana |
---|---|---|---|
Weekday | AED 200–250 | AED 1,500+ | AED 3,000+ |
Weekend | AED 300–400 | AED 2,000+ | AED 3,500+ |
Insider Tips to Maximize Your Visit
- Arrive Early: Spots fill up by 11:00 AM on weekends.
- Reserve in Advance: Especially during winter months and public holidays.
- Go Midweek: You’ll enjoy the same luxury without the crowd.
- Try the House Rosé: It’s chilled to perfection and pairs well with seafood.
- Bring a Power Bank: Outlets are limited near loungers.
Common Questions About Drift Beach Dubai
Is it family-friendly?
No. Drift is adults-only (21+), making it ideal for couples, solo travelers, and groups of friends.
Is there valet parking?
Yes, complimentary valet is available for guests.
Can I access the beach without a day pass?
No. Entry requires reservation and payment — no walk-ins allowed during peak hours.
Do they offer spa services?
While Drift doesn’t have its own spa, guests can book treatments at the nearby One&Only Spa within the resort.
